Crystal Bridges shows art documentary

Crystal Bridges at the Massey in Bentonville will screen Who Gets to Call It Art? - a film about the New York art scene in the 1960s as seen through the eyes of Henry Geldzahler, the first contemporary art curator at the Metropolitan Museum of Art, 10:30 a.m.-1 p.m. Jan. 23. The documentary features artist interviews and tells the story of a decade of art history. The event is free. Attendees are encouraged to bring their own lunches.
